"This school only caters to one type of student. Unfortunately, if you're not that type, you'll have trouble succeeding at PFTSTA. As a student, I felt that I wasn't allowed to be just that -- a student. In the 7th grade they expected us to be adults and treated us like we were dumb if we showed any sort of a childlike personality. The teachers and administrators were not open to every type of person. My faith was constantly being tested and I actually had a faculty member get very angry at my mother and I because I was too shy. There are a ton of students and parents who love this school and I'm sure it opens up many doors academically. But please keep in mind that schools are about more than just academics."

"I attend Patrick F Taylor, I'm in 8th. I enjoy Patrick Taylor a lot. I have many friends and not just in my grade but others above and below me. I have transportation from my neighborhood, across the Huey P Long Bridge, to my Eastbank school. Patrick Taylor is a regional school so it accepts students from the East and West bank. In relation to other schools I am able to attend, I believe that Patrick Taylor is the better school for me because I am a very capable student, but unlike other students in my parish that are capable and attend magnet schools, they don t apply themselves and put forth as much effort as I do. Patrick Taylor provides a challenge for me, one that will challenge me to go beyond just having potential. When I accomplish goals, I feel very satisfied, but nevertheless, I strive to do better."
